  1. Jack Kirkwood (August 6, 1894 – August 2, 1964) was a Scottish-American actor, comedian and vaudevillian. He was known for playing the role of Charley Hackett in the American sitcom television series One Happy Family. [1]

    Actor: Fancy Pants. Jack Kirkwood was born on 6 August 1894 in Scotland, UK. He was an actor, known for Fancy Pants (1950), The Rifleman (1958) and Never a Dull Moment (1950). He died on 2 August 1964 in Las Vegas, Nevada, USA.
